Feb 10, 2016· re VRM vs Ball Mill for Cement Grinding. Specific power consumption- high for ball mill and Low for VRM ; Maintenance costs- high for VRM and low for Ball mill ; Process control/process technology- ball is operation friendlt and simple in operation but VRM requires some PID or control technology.

C15 transferred the raw materials to the vertical roller mill (VRM) as the raw materials should be finish-ground before being fed into the kiln for clinkering. This process is done in the VRM. The raw materials are simultaneously dried using hot air in order to get good quality cement.

Vertical Roller Mill (VRM) The power used for the actual grinding process while grinding raw materials, depends mainly on the hardness of raw materials and the type of mill used, i.e. ball mill or vertical roller mill. Typically, the motor of the ball mill consumes about 14 - 15 kWh/ ton of raw mix whereas the VRM .

The OK™ mill has been FL's standard cement VRM since 1993. Since its introduction the OK mill has proven to be the most efficient cement VRM available with the highest reliability and ease of operation. In 2017, FL introduced the OK raw mill, which is designed with the same proven technology and modular design as the OK cement mill.

: Cement is obtained by grinding various raw materials after . The degree calcination to which cement is ground to smaller and smaller particles is called fineness of cement. The fineness of cement has an important on the rate of hydration and hence on the rate of role gain of strength and also on the rate of evolution of heat.

applications of the vertical roller mill for cement grinding are less prevalent. The two-compartment ball mill operating in a closed circuit with a high efficiency separator is thus still the most preferred arrangement for new cement grinding installations although the vertical roller mill now has emerged as a viable alternative
